五分钟彻底读懂区块链:从比特币创世区块看区块链到底是什么链
# 区块链的基础概念
区块链,作为一种新兴的技术,近年来在全球范围内引起了广泛的关注。它是一种分布式账本技术,具有去中心化、不可篡改、安全可靠等特点。
区块链的起源可以追溯到2008年,当时一个名为中本聪的人发表了一篇名为《比特币:一种点对点的电子现金系统》的论文,提出了比特币的概念。比特币是一种数字货币,它的交易记录被存储在一个分布式账本中,这个账本就是区块链。
区块链的基本定义是:它是一种分布式账本技术,由多个节点共同维护,每个节点都有一份完整的账本副本。区块链中的数据以区块的形式存储,每个区块包含了一定数量的交易记录和一个时间戳。时间戳是指区块生成的时间,它保证了区块链中数据的顺序性和不可篡改性。
区块链中的区块由以下几个要素构成:
1. **数据**:区块中包含了一定数量的交易记录,这些交易记录是区块链中最重要的信息。
2. **时间戳**:时间戳是指区块生成的时间,它保证了区块链中数据的顺序性和不可篡改性。
3. **哈希值**:哈希值是指区块的唯一标识符,它是通过对区块中的数据进行哈希算法计算得到的。哈希算法是一种加密算法,它可以将任意长度的数据转换为固定长度的哈希值。哈希值的特点是唯一性和不可逆性,即不同的区块数据会产生不同的哈希值,而且无法通过哈希值反推出原始数据。
4. **前一个区块的哈希值**:每个区块中都包含了前一个区块的哈希值,这样就形成了一个链式结构。通过这种链式结构,区块链中的所有区块都被连接在一起,形成了一个不可篡改的账本。
区块链中的链是通过哈希算法等连接起来的。具体来说,每个区块的哈希值是通过对该区块中的数据进行哈希算法计算得到的,而前一个区块的哈希值则被包含在当前区块中。这样,当一个新的区块被添加到区块链中时,它的哈希值就会与前一个区块的哈希值进行关联,从而形成一个链式结构。
为了更好地理解区块链的概念,我们可以结合比特币创世区块的例子来进行说明。比特币创世区块是比特币区块链中的第一个区块,它于2009年1月3日被创建。创世区块中包含了一条简短的消息:“The Times 03/Jan/2009 Chancellor on brink of second bailout for banks”,这条消息是当时《泰晤士报》的头版标题。
比特币创世区块的诞生背景是2008年全球金融危机,当时传统金融体系受到了严重的冲击,人们开始寻求一种更加安全、可靠的支付方式。比特币的出现,正是为了满足人们对去中心化、安全可靠支付方式的需求。
比特币创世区块的创建,标志着区块链技术的诞生。从此,区块链技术开始逐渐发展壮大,并在数字货币、金融、供应链管理、物联网、版权保护等领域得到了广泛的应用。
总之,区块链是一种分布式账本技术,它具有去中心化、不可篡改、安全可靠等特点。区块链中的区块由数据、时间戳、哈希值和前一个区块的哈希值等要素构成,通过哈希算法等连接起来,形成了一个不可篡改的账本。比特币创世区块的诞生背景,标志着区块链技术的诞生,从此区块链技术开始逐渐发展壮大,并在各个领域得到了广泛的应用。
# 区块链的工作原理
区块链是一种去中心化的分布式账本技术,它通过一系列复杂的机制实现了账本的一致性维护和交易记录。
## 去中心化的实现
区块链通过多个节点共同维护账本,不存在单一的中心控制点。每个节点都拥有完整的账本副本,当有新的交易发生时,各个节点都会接收到相关信息。节点之间通过网络进行通信,共同验证交易的合法性。这种去中心化的结构使得任何单个节点的故障或恶意攻击都不会影响整个系统的正常运行,大大提高了系统的可靠性和安全性。
## 节点共同维护账本一致性
各个节点通过共识机制来共同维护账本的一致性。当一个新的区块被创建时,节点们会根据共识算法来决定是否将该区块添加到区块链中。例如工作量证明机制,矿工们需要通过解决复杂的数学难题来证明自己的工作量,只有最先解决难题的矿工才能获得创建新区块的权利,并将新区块广播给其他节点。其他节点在接收到新区块后,会验证其合法性,如果验证通过,则将该区块添加到自己的账本中。通过这种方式,所有节点的账本在不断同步更新,保持一致性。
## 共识机制的作用
1. **工作量证明(PoW)**:如比特币采用的工作量证明机制,要求矿工投入大量的计算资源来解决哈希难题。解决难题的过程需要消耗大量的电力和时间,这就保证了只有付出足够工作量的节点才能获得记账权,从而防止了恶意节点轻易篡改账本。同时,工作量证明也为区块链提供了一定的安全性和稳定性。例如,比特币网络每10分钟左右会产生一个新区块,这是通过矿工们竞争解决难题来实现的。
2. **权益证明(PoS)**:权益证明机制根据节点持有的数字货币数量和时间来确定其记账权。持有数字货币越多、时间越长的节点,获得记账权的概率就越大。与工作量证明相比,权益证明不需要大量的计算资源消耗,降低了能源浪费,提高了系统的效率。例如,以太坊在后续版本中计划引入权益证明机制,以提升其性能和可持续性。
## 交易记录过程
1. **交易发起**:用户通过钱包或其他客户端发起一笔交易,交易信息包含发送方、接收方、交易金额等。
2. **交易验证**:交易信息首先在本地钱包进行初步验证,确保格式正确等。然后广播到网络中的其他节点,节点们会根据共识机制和预设的规则对交易进行验证。例如,验证发送方是否有足够的余额来支付交易金额等。
3. **交易记录**:当交易通过验证后,会被打包到一个新的区块中。随着新区块不断被创建和添加到区块链上,交易也就被永久记录下来。例如,在以太坊网络中,用户发起的智能合约交易,经过一系列验证后,会被记录在区块链上,并且智能合约会按照预设的逻辑自动执行。
区块链通过去中心化、节点共同维护账本一致性以及共识机制等一系列原理,实现了安全、可靠、透明的交易记录,为众多领域带来了创新的解决方案。
《区块链的应用场景》
区块链作为一种新兴技术,在多个领域展现出了巨大的应用潜力。
在金融领域,区块链有着广泛的应用。数字货币是其中最为人熟知的应用之一。比特币作为第一个成功的数字货币,基于区块链技术实现了去中心化的交易。它无需通过传统的金融机构进行清算,交易双方可以直接进行点对点的价值转移。跨境支付也是区块链的重要应用场景。传统跨境支付往往流程繁琐、费用高昂且耗时较长。而利用区块链技术,跨境支付可以实现快速、低成本的资金转移。例如,Ripple公司的区块链支付解决方案,通过分布式账本,大幅缩短了跨境支付的时间,降低了手续费。
在供应链管理中,区块链提高了透明度和可追溯性。每一个环节的信息都被记录在区块链上,从原材料采购到产品最终交付,整个过程都可查可追。比如沃尔玛与IBM合作,利用区块链技术追踪食品供应链。消费者可以通过扫描产品二维码,获取产品从生产到销售的详细信息,包括产地、生产日期、运输路线等,有效保障了食品安全。
在物联网领域,区块链也发挥着重要作用。物联网设备产生大量的数据,区块链可以确保这些数据的安全存储和共享。例如,在智能家居系统中,不同设备之间的数据交互可以通过区块链进行验证和授权,防止数据泄露和恶意攻击。
版权保护方面,区块链为数字内容的版权管理提供了新的解决方案。通过区块链记录作品的创作过程、版权归属等信息,一旦发生侵权行为,可以快速追溯和举证。比如,一些音乐平台利用区块链技术,确保音乐创作者的版权得到有效保护。
然而,区块链应用也面临着诸多挑战。技术方面,性能和扩展性有待提高,以满足大规模应用的需求。安全问题也不容忽视,虽然区块链本身具有一定的安全性,但仍可能遭受黑客攻击。此外,法律法规的不完善也给区块链应用带来了一定的阻碍。
未来,区块链有望在更多领域得到应用和发展。随着技术的不断成熟,其性能和安全性将不断提升。与其他技术的融合也将创造更多新的应用场景,为社会发展带来更大的变革。
区块链,作为一种新兴的技术,近年来在全球范围内引起了广泛的关注。它是一种分布式账本技术,具有去中心化、不可篡改、安全可靠等特点。
区块链的起源可以追溯到2008年,当时一个名为中本聪的人发表了一篇名为《比特币:一种点对点的电子现金系统》的论文,提出了比特币的概念。比特币是一种数字货币,它的交易记录被存储在一个分布式账本中,这个账本就是区块链。
区块链的基本定义是:它是一种分布式账本技术,由多个节点共同维护,每个节点都有一份完整的账本副本。区块链中的数据以区块的形式存储,每个区块包含了一定数量的交易记录和一个时间戳。时间戳是指区块生成的时间,它保证了区块链中数据的顺序性和不可篡改性。
区块链中的区块由以下几个要素构成:
1. **数据**:区块中包含了一定数量的交易记录,这些交易记录是区块链中最重要的信息。
2. **时间戳**:时间戳是指区块生成的时间,它保证了区块链中数据的顺序性和不可篡改性。
3. **哈希值**:哈希值是指区块的唯一标识符,它是通过对区块中的数据进行哈希算法计算得到的。哈希算法是一种加密算法,它可以将任意长度的数据转换为固定长度的哈希值。哈希值的特点是唯一性和不可逆性,即不同的区块数据会产生不同的哈希值,而且无法通过哈希值反推出原始数据。
4. **前一个区块的哈希值**:每个区块中都包含了前一个区块的哈希值,这样就形成了一个链式结构。通过这种链式结构,区块链中的所有区块都被连接在一起,形成了一个不可篡改的账本。
区块链中的链是通过哈希算法等连接起来的。具体来说,每个区块的哈希值是通过对该区块中的数据进行哈希算法计算得到的,而前一个区块的哈希值则被包含在当前区块中。这样,当一个新的区块被添加到区块链中时,它的哈希值就会与前一个区块的哈希值进行关联,从而形成一个链式结构。
为了更好地理解区块链的概念,我们可以结合比特币创世区块的例子来进行说明。比特币创世区块是比特币区块链中的第一个区块,它于2009年1月3日被创建。创世区块中包含了一条简短的消息:“The Times 03/Jan/2009 Chancellor on brink of second bailout for banks”,这条消息是当时《泰晤士报》的头版标题。
比特币创世区块的诞生背景是2008年全球金融危机,当时传统金融体系受到了严重的冲击,人们开始寻求一种更加安全、可靠的支付方式。比特币的出现,正是为了满足人们对去中心化、安全可靠支付方式的需求。
比特币创世区块的创建,标志着区块链技术的诞生。从此,区块链技术开始逐渐发展壮大,并在数字货币、金融、供应链管理、物联网、版权保护等领域得到了广泛的应用。
总之,区块链是一种分布式账本技术,它具有去中心化、不可篡改、安全可靠等特点。区块链中的区块由数据、时间戳、哈希值和前一个区块的哈希值等要素构成,通过哈希算法等连接起来,形成了一个不可篡改的账本。比特币创世区块的诞生背景,标志着区块链技术的诞生,从此区块链技术开始逐渐发展壮大,并在各个领域得到了广泛的应用。
# 区块链的工作原理
区块链是一种去中心化的分布式账本技术,它通过一系列复杂的机制实现了账本的一致性维护和交易记录。
## 去中心化的实现
区块链通过多个节点共同维护账本,不存在单一的中心控制点。每个节点都拥有完整的账本副本,当有新的交易发生时,各个节点都会接收到相关信息。节点之间通过网络进行通信,共同验证交易的合法性。这种去中心化的结构使得任何单个节点的故障或恶意攻击都不会影响整个系统的正常运行,大大提高了系统的可靠性和安全性。
## 节点共同维护账本一致性
各个节点通过共识机制来共同维护账本的一致性。当一个新的区块被创建时,节点们会根据共识算法来决定是否将该区块添加到区块链中。例如工作量证明机制,矿工们需要通过解决复杂的数学难题来证明自己的工作量,只有最先解决难题的矿工才能获得创建新区块的权利,并将新区块广播给其他节点。其他节点在接收到新区块后,会验证其合法性,如果验证通过,则将该区块添加到自己的账本中。通过这种方式,所有节点的账本在不断同步更新,保持一致性。
## 共识机制的作用
1. **工作量证明(PoW)**:如比特币采用的工作量证明机制,要求矿工投入大量的计算资源来解决哈希难题。解决难题的过程需要消耗大量的电力和时间,这就保证了只有付出足够工作量的节点才能获得记账权,从而防止了恶意节点轻易篡改账本。同时,工作量证明也为区块链提供了一定的安全性和稳定性。例如,比特币网络每10分钟左右会产生一个新区块,这是通过矿工们竞争解决难题来实现的。
2. **权益证明(PoS)**:权益证明机制根据节点持有的数字货币数量和时间来确定其记账权。持有数字货币越多、时间越长的节点,获得记账权的概率就越大。与工作量证明相比,权益证明不需要大量的计算资源消耗,降低了能源浪费,提高了系统的效率。例如,以太坊在后续版本中计划引入权益证明机制,以提升其性能和可持续性。
## 交易记录过程
1. **交易发起**:用户通过钱包或其他客户端发起一笔交易,交易信息包含发送方、接收方、交易金额等。
2. **交易验证**:交易信息首先在本地钱包进行初步验证,确保格式正确等。然后广播到网络中的其他节点,节点们会根据共识机制和预设的规则对交易进行验证。例如,验证发送方是否有足够的余额来支付交易金额等。
3. **交易记录**:当交易通过验证后,会被打包到一个新的区块中。随着新区块不断被创建和添加到区块链上,交易也就被永久记录下来。例如,在以太坊网络中,用户发起的智能合约交易,经过一系列验证后,会被记录在区块链上,并且智能合约会按照预设的逻辑自动执行。
区块链通过去中心化、节点共同维护账本一致性以及共识机制等一系列原理,实现了安全、可靠、透明的交易记录,为众多领域带来了创新的解决方案。
《区块链的应用场景》
区块链作为一种新兴技术,在多个领域展现出了巨大的应用潜力。
在金融领域,区块链有着广泛的应用。数字货币是其中最为人熟知的应用之一。比特币作为第一个成功的数字货币,基于区块链技术实现了去中心化的交易。它无需通过传统的金融机构进行清算,交易双方可以直接进行点对点的价值转移。跨境支付也是区块链的重要应用场景。传统跨境支付往往流程繁琐、费用高昂且耗时较长。而利用区块链技术,跨境支付可以实现快速、低成本的资金转移。例如,Ripple公司的区块链支付解决方案,通过分布式账本,大幅缩短了跨境支付的时间,降低了手续费。
在供应链管理中,区块链提高了透明度和可追溯性。每一个环节的信息都被记录在区块链上,从原材料采购到产品最终交付,整个过程都可查可追。比如沃尔玛与IBM合作,利用区块链技术追踪食品供应链。消费者可以通过扫描产品二维码,获取产品从生产到销售的详细信息,包括产地、生产日期、运输路线等,有效保障了食品安全。
在物联网领域,区块链也发挥着重要作用。物联网设备产生大量的数据,区块链可以确保这些数据的安全存储和共享。例如,在智能家居系统中,不同设备之间的数据交互可以通过区块链进行验证和授权,防止数据泄露和恶意攻击。
版权保护方面,区块链为数字内容的版权管理提供了新的解决方案。通过区块链记录作品的创作过程、版权归属等信息,一旦发生侵权行为,可以快速追溯和举证。比如,一些音乐平台利用区块链技术,确保音乐创作者的版权得到有效保护。
然而,区块链应用也面临着诸多挑战。技术方面,性能和扩展性有待提高,以满足大规模应用的需求。安全问题也不容忽视,虽然区块链本身具有一定的安全性,但仍可能遭受黑客攻击。此外,法律法规的不完善也给区块链应用带来了一定的阻碍。
未来,区块链有望在更多领域得到应用和发展。随着技术的不断成熟,其性能和安全性将不断提升。与其他技术的融合也将创造更多新的应用场景,为社会发展带来更大的变革。
更多五分钟彻底读懂区块链:从比特币创世区块看区块链到底是什么链相关问题
问题:《muonline》星云火链卷轴是用来坑新手玩家的吗?
回答:*,这哪个mod,想要 详情 >
问题:《muonline》新手圣导师,请教一下加点和技能问题。
回答:三国群英传8是手游,玩之前默默念三遍,心里就释然了。 详情 >
问题:《鬼谷八荒》极难刀修怎么玩啊
回答:IFF敌我识别+夜视模块:本MOD可以高亮敌对NPC,队友,中立NPC甚至可以高亮陷阱,让你再也不会误中敌人设的陷阱了(貌似地雷不能高亮) 详情 >
问题:《中世纪2全面战争》护甲到底有多重要?2甲和5甲差距很大吗?
回答:【引子】西奈故事之后的某天,巴耶克接到了阿蒙内特(艾雅)的一封信,信中说在底比斯出现了另个同样圣物(伊甸苹果)的踪迹,于是巴耶克开启了前往这个上埃及阿蒙神发祥地的调查之旅。 详情 >
问题:《nba2k》所谓系统局到底有何存在意义?
回答:再放几个充电的进电网,放电会持续最大值放,充电会占满负荷但不会溢出,这样就可以持续烧氢了 详情 >
评论 (0)
